Content-Language: en-US, de-DE To: Miklos Szeredi , Jaco Kroon Cc: linux-fsdevel@vger.kernel.org, linux-kernel@vger.kernel.org, Randy Dunlap , Antonio SJ Musumeci References: <20230726105953.843-1-jaco@uls.co.za> <20230727081237.18217-1-jaco@uls.co.za> From: Bernd Schubert In-Reply-To: Content-Type: text/plain; charset=UTF-8; format=flowed Content-Transfer-Encoding: 7bit Precedence: bulk List-ID: X-Mailing-List: linux-fsdevel@vger.kernel.org On 7/27/23 17:35, Miklos Szeredi wrote: > On Thu, 27 Jul 2023 at 10:13, Jaco Kroon wrote: >> >> This patch does not mess with the caching infrastructure like the >> previous one, which we believe caused excessive CPU and broke directory >> listings in some cases. >> >> This version only affects the uncached read, which then during parse adds an >> entry at a time to the cached structures by way of copying, and as such, >> we believe this should be sufficient. >> >> We're still seeing cases where getdents64 takes ~10s (this was the case >> in any case without this patch, the difference now that we get ~500 >> entries for that time rather than the 14-18 previously). We believe >> that that latency is introduced on glusterfs side and is under separate >> discussion with the glusterfs developers. >> >> This is still a compile-time option, but a working one compared to >> previous patch.
